![Zymotic Deathrate. There were only 3 deaths from the principal infectious diseases, 1 less than last year. Two of these were due to diarrhoea and 1 due to measles. This gives an exceptional!}^ low zymotic deatlu’ate of 0.07. The rate for the Administrative County was 0.09. Fortunately there were no deaths from puerperal causes during 1948. This gives a Nil maternal mortality rate, which is very satisfactory. The rate for the Administrative County which is the lowest on record was 1.24. There were 41 deaths in infants under 1 year of age, compared with only 28 last year. This gives an infant mortality rate of 55 which is high compared with 34 for England and Wales and 32 for 148 smaller towns. The rate for the Administrative County was 39, which is the lowest on record.
